The door panels are not that hard to get off, just dont break anything buy trying to force anything off. I hope I remember this correctly:
Fronts Doors:
1. Remove surround around door handle and undo bolt behind door handle.
2. Remove cussion on arm rest undo bolt under it.
3. Remove bolt in door arm rest handle and then remove switch panel on door and undo clips to power windows and lock.
4. Remove cover over clip at a-piller undo clip.
5. Remove door panel held on by clips around the sides.
Rear Doors:
1. Remove surround around door handle and remove screw behind door handle.
2. Remove arm rest its just two bolts.
3. Remove door panel held on by clips around the sides.
4. Remember that the all electrical connections will have to be undone.
Remember that you will have to solder the connections for the new speakers since there are no adaptors to just plug the new speakers in.
